目的:采用静息态下低频振幅(ALFF)与功能连接的方法,观察长期使用海洛因对大脑相关脑区局部神经元的基线活动影响,并分析这些相关脑区神经活动改变与大脑功能组织模式的关系。方法采集17例海洛因依赖者和15例正常被试者的 fMRI 数据,分析海洛因依赖者 ALFF 的变化及其与使用海洛因的关系。以产生差异脑区为感兴趣区,用功能连接方法分析海洛因依赖者功能连接的改变。结果与对照组相比,海洛因依赖者的右侧尾状核、右背侧前扣带回、右额上回的 ALFF 明显降低,而双侧小脑、左颞上回和左枕上回 ALFF 增加。以上脑区中,仅右侧尾状核的 ALFF 值与海洛因使用总时间及每日剂量呈负相关。功能连接分析显示右侧尾状核和背外侧前额叶皮层(dlPFC)的功能连接降低,与小脑的功能连接增强。结论海洛因依赖者基线水平大脑神经元ALFF 减少伴随着大脑功能连接的失调;慢性海洛因依赖者前额-纹状体环路和前额-小脑环路功能失调,后者支持小脑内部模型理论以及促成成瘾者从机械行为向成瘾习惯的转换。

Objective To explore heroin-induced damages on partial neural activities,and to analyze the relationship between these damages and the brain mode in functional organizationby observing its resting-state amplitude of low-frequency fluctuation (ALFF)and functional connectivity.Methods Gathering fMRI scans of 1 7 male heroin dependent individuals and 1 5 equivalent nor-mal subjects at their resting-state,using Rest and Dparsf software to analyze changes of ALFF in the brain regions of heroin depend-ent individuals;the relationship between ALFF changes with these individual’s previous heroin consuming state was also analyzed. Then taking the differentiated brain parts as ROI,using functional connectivity method to analyze the changes of the connections of addiction-related alteration in the whole brain in the heroin dependent individuals.Results Compared with normal control group,the ALFF of heroin dependent individuals was reduced in the right caudate,right superior medial frontal cortex,and right dorsal anterior cingulate cortex (dACC),while increased in the left superior temporal gyrus,bilateral cerebellum,and left superior occipital gyrus. In these brain regions,only the value of the right caudate ALFF had a negative correlation with the overall time of heroin use.The functional connectivity between right caudate and dorsolateral prefrontal cortex (dlPFC)was reduced,while the functional connectiv-ity between the right caudate and cerebellum was increased.Conclusion The reduction of ALFF and dysfunction of functional con-nectivity in heroin dependent individuals,and the dysfunction in the fronto-striatal and fronto-cerebell circuit,which may support the cerebellar internal model theory and contribute to the transformation from mechanical behaviors to addictive habits.
